1. Precise Breakthrough: "Customized Shredding Logic" for Different Components

A scrap car is composed of thousands of components with different materials, and the shredder needs to "tailor" according to the characteristics of different components.

(1) Bumpers and Instrument Panels: Dual Tests of Wear Resistance and Efficiency

    These components are mostly made of reinforced engineering plastics such as ABS and PPO, and glass fibers are added to improve strength. Zhengzhou Yuxi is equipped with a crusher with high-wear-resistant manganese steel cutters. The wear-resistant design of the cutters and the inner wall of the crushing chamber can cope with the strong abrasion of glass fibers. In a recycling base in Henan, its automated crushing line realizes a one-stop operation of "feeding - crushing - sorting - bagging", and 1 worker can complete the work that traditionally requires 3-5 people, improving efficiency by 50%.

(2) Tires: "Full Resource Recycling" with Multi-stage Shredding

    Tires are composed of rubber, steel wire and fiber. Yuxi's tire crushing production line adopts the process of "shredding - coarse crushing - fine crushing - sorting": first shred the entire tire, then separate rubber from steel wire and fiber by rubbing, and finally produce pure rubber particles (which can be used for plastic runways and rubber floors) and steel wire (recycled for steelmaking). After a certain industrial park in Shandong introduced this production line, it handles 100,000 tons of waste tires annually, turning "black pollution" into a "resource gold mine".

(3) Brake Pads: "Intelligent Sorting" of Metal and Non-Metal

    Brake pads are divided into two types: metal (made by Metal Injection Molding (MIM) process) and non-metal (made by bonding asbestos, rubber and other raw materials). Yuxi's equipment uses magnetic separation + special wear-resistant shredders to first distinguish between metal and non-metal friction blocks, and then crush and recycle the non-metal blocks. Even if adhesives are added, material reuse can be achieved, solving the pain point of "difficult to separate mixed materials" in traditional dismantling.

2. Technical Core: Innovative Support from "Hardware" to "System"

The scrap car shredder of Zhengzhou Yuxi is not a single equipment, but a complete system of "hardware + process + service".

(1) Hardware Precision: A Durability Revolution in Cutters and Structure

    • Cutter Process: After multiple processes such as surfacing, forging, and repeated heating, four types of high-hardness materials such as H13, SKD11, D2, and DC53 are available, with a hardness of 60-65HRC, ensuring "wear resistance without chipping" when shredding complex materials such as metal, plastic, and rubber.

    • Whole Machine Structure: The shell is welded with thick manganese steel plates, and the inner lining is firm and durable; the main shaft is a forged part and strengthened by heat treatment, and is matched with self-aligning roller bearings, which can automatically adjust the angular error and adapt to low-speed and high-torque working conditions. The motor power ranges from 110-315kW to meet different production capacity requirements.

(2) System Integration: Coordinated Optimization of Environmental Protection and Efficiency

    The equipment is equipped with a pulse dust removal + water circulation system, and the dust emission during the crushing process is less than 10mg/m³, with zero wastewater discharge, fully complying with the EPA (U.S. Environmental Protection Agency) environmental standards. Frequently Asked Questions

Q: Can scrap car shredders only handle cars?

A: No. It can also shred a variety of waste metals such as old bicycles, motorcycles, car cabs, old steel, and aluminum furniture. The discharge particle size can be adjusted according to user needs, and the application scenarios are very wide.

Q: What should be paid most attention to when choosing a scrap car shredder?

A: It is necessary to focus on shredding force (whether it can handle complex materials), cutter wear resistance (affecting equipment life), sorting accuracy (determining resource value), environmental configuration (whether it meets EPA standards), as well as the manufacturer's customized service and after-sales service capabilities.
